Hodnotenie:
Kniha sa zaoberá kognitívnymi procesmi súvisiacimi s programovaním a ponúka techniky na zlepšenie kvality kódu a jeho pochopenia. Získala zmiešané recenzie, pričom mnohí chvália jej vedecký základ a praktické aplikácie, zatiaľ čo iní ju kritizujú za prílišnú rozvláčnosť a nedostatok obsahu.
Výhody:⬤ Vysvetľuje kognitívne procesy, ktoré stoja za čítaním a písaním kódu.
⬤ Poskytuje vedecky podložené techniky na zlepšenie porozumenia kódu a jeho kvality.
⬤ Ponúka praktické aplikácie a cvičenia vhodné pre všetky úrovne zručností.
⬤ Témy ako konvencie pomenovania a štýl kódovania sú zdôraznené ako dôležité pre čitateľnosť kódu.
⬤ Osloví pedagógov aj skúsených vývojárov.
⬤ Niektorí čitatelia považujú knihu za príliš rozvláčnu a opakujúcu sa, s nadmerným množstvom úvodného materiálu.
⬤ Kritici tvrdia, že niektoré časti pôsobia skôr ako svojpomoc, než ako akademické skúmanie kognitívnych vied.
⬤ Niektorí recenzenti mali pocit, že navrhovaným myšlienkam chýba praktická použiteľnosť v širokom meradle.
⬤ Niekoľko z nich považovalo knihu za nudnú alebo sa snažilo zaujať jej obsahom, pričom uviedli, že mohla byť stručnejšia.
(na základe 18 čitateľských recenzií)
The Programmer's Brain: What Every Programmer Needs to Know about Cognition
Váš mozog reaguje predvídateľným spôsobom, keď sa stretne s novými alebo náročnými úlohami. Táto jedinečná kniha vás naučí konkrétne techniky založené na kognitívnej vede, ktoré zlepšia spôsob, akým sa učíte a premýšľate o kóde.
Zhrnutie.
V knihe Mozog programátora: V knihe Mozog: Čo potrebuje každý programátor vedieť o poznávaní sa dozviete:
Rýchle a efektívne spôsoby, ako si osvojiť nové programovacie jazyky.
Zručnosti rýchleho čítania na rýchle pochopenie nového kódu.
Techniky na odhalenie významu zložitého kódu.
Spôsoby, ako sa naučiť novú syntax a udržať si ju v pamäti.
Písanie kódu, ktorý je pre ostatných ľahko čitateľný.
Výber správnych názvov premenných.
Zlepšenie zrozumiteľnosti vašej kódovej základne pre nováčikov.
Zapájanie nových vývojárov do vášho tímu.
Naučte sa, ako optimalizovať prirodzené kognitívne procesy svojho mozgu, aby ste ľahšie čítali kód, rýchlejšie písali kód a osvojili si nové jazyky za oveľa kratší čas. Táto kniha vám pomôže prekonať zmätok, ktorý pociťujete, keď sa stretávate s cudzím a zložitým kódom, a vysvetliť kódovú základňu spôsobom, vďaka ktorému môže byť nový člen tímu produktívny už za niekoľko dní!
Predslov napísal Jon Skeet.
Zakúpenie tlačenej knihy zahŕňa bezplatnú elektronickú knihu vo formátoch PDF, Kindle a ePub od vydavateľstva Manning Publications.
O technológiách: Kniha je určená pre všetkých používateľov, ktorí sa chcú naučiť pracovať s technológiami.
Využite prirodzené procesy svojho mozgu, aby ste sa stali lepším programátorom. Techniky založené na kognitívnej vede umožňujú rýchlejšie sa naučiť nové jazyky, zvýšiť produktivitu, znížiť potrebu prepisovania kódu a mnoho ďalšieho. Táto jedinečná kniha vám pomôže dosiahnuť tieto úspechy.
O knihe.
Kniha Mozog programátora odomyká spôsob, akým premýšľame o kóde. Ponúka vedecky podložené techniky, ktoré môžu radikálne zlepšiť spôsob, akým si osvojujete nové technológie, chápete kód a zapamätávate si syntax. Naučíte sa, ako ťažiť z produktívneho boja a premeniť zmätok na nástroj učenia. Popri tom zistíte, ako vytvárať študijné zdroje, keď sa stanete expertom na učenie seba samého a na privádzanie nových kolegov do tempa.
Čo nájdete vo vnútri.
Pochopte, ako váš mozog vidí kód.
Zručnosti rýchleho čítania na rýchle naučenie sa kódu.
Techniky na rozlúštenie zložitého kódu.
Tipy na vytváranie zrozumiteľných kódových databáz.
O čitateľovi.
Pre programátorov, ktorí majú skúsenosti s prácou vo viac ako jednom jazyku.
O autorovi.
Dr. Felienne Hermans je docentkou na Leidenskej univerzite v Holandsku. Posledné desaťročie sa venuje výskumu programovania, jeho výučby a učenia.
Obsah: V knihe sa venuje problematike programovania.
ČASŤ 1 O LEPŠOM ČÍTANÍ KÓDU.
1 Dekódovanie vášho zmätku pri kódovaní.
2 Rýchle čítanie kódu.
3 Ako sa rýchlo naučiť syntax programovania.
4 Ako čítať zložitý kód.
ČASŤ 2 O PREMÝŠĽANÍ O KÓDE.
5 Dosiahnutie hlbšieho porozumenia kódu.
6 Ako sa zlepšiť v riešení programátorských problémov.
7 Mylné predstavy: Chyby v myslení.
ČASŤ 3 O PÍSANÍ LEPŠIEHO KÓDU.
8 Ako sa zlepšiť v pomenovávaní vecí.
9 Vyhýbanie sa zlému kódu a kognitívnej záťaži: Dva rámce.
10 Ako sa zlepšiť v riešení zložitých problémov.
ČASŤ 4 O SPOLUPRÁCI NA KÓDE.
11 Akt písania kódu.
12 Navrhovanie a zlepšovanie väčších systémov.
13 Ako zapracovať nových vývojárov.
© Book1 Group - všetky práva vyhradené.
Obsah tejto stránky nesmie byť kopírovaný ani použitý čiastočne alebo v celku bez písomného súhlasu vlastníka.
Posledná úprava: 2024.11.13 22:11 (GMT)